Types of Tournament Formats

1. Knockout (Elimination) Tournaments

Players are eliminated after a set number of losses or when their chips run out. The last remaining player wins. Popular in poker, these tournaments often have a clear winner and a straightforward structure.

2. Sit & Go Tournaments

Single-table events that start when a predetermined number of players have registered, typically 6-10. They are ideal for quick sessions, with winners taking a larger percentage of the prize pool.

3. Scheduled Multi-Table Tournaments (MTTs)

These tournaments run at scheduled times with hundreds or thousands of participants. They often feature progressive prize pools, with the top finishers sharing a significant reward, sometimes exceeding $10,000.

4. Spin & Go Tournaments

Fast-paced, three-player tournaments with a randomized prize pool, often ranging from 2x to 10,000x the buy-in. They are perfect for quick thrill-seekers.

5. Bounty Tournaments

Players earn rewards for eliminating opponents, adding an extra layer of strategy. Bounty formats can be combined with other tournament types for increased excitement.
